Insights into Spire's Waste Treatment Practices

In 2023, Spire generated a total of 3,511 metric tonnes of waste.

Of this amount, 4.78% of Spire's total waste generated was recovered through methods such as recycling, reuse, or composting, while 95.22% was disposed of through landfilling, incineration, or combustion.

Spire's Waste Recovery Rate

5%

How much of Spire's waste is recycled or recovered?

In 2023, Spire reported a total waste generation of 3,511 metric tonnes, of which 4.78% was recovered through recycling, reuse, or composting. This low recovery rate highlights limited waste diversion and suggests that Spire may be relying more heavily on landfill or incineration, underscoring opportunities for stronger resource recovery initiatives.
